DATE : 10/12/2005
TIME : 05:25AM
WEATHER : LIGHT RAIN
ROAD CONDITION : WET
CAR1 : 2001 ACURA INTEGRA TYPE-R
CAR2 : 2004 HONDA CIVIC COUPE

This morning i was on my way to church for early monring service which i go every morning. I was driving and noticed that the lights weren't working properly at the 3way intersection and was just flashing but I still had a right of way since mine was flahsing yellow and other two sides were flashing red.
FLASHING RED MEANS STOP!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
I saw one car coming from the left side but since I had the right away i proceeded through the intersection and next thing i noticed was him right in front of me.
Both of the airbags deployed, car bounced back facing other direction still in shock of accident+impact of airbag. i stood still holding steering wheel tight.
After few moments, i get out all confused and see other guy not wanting to get out of the car. 11 Local cruisers + 1 State cruiser + 2 fire trucks + 1 ambulence came to the scene in few moments. The other party was sent away in ambulence claiming he has heart problem and back pain. WTF!!!!!
After looking through the cars and discussing with other police officers, state trooper comes to me and ask me couple question to verify the situation.
After hearing from me, he told me I'm not at fault because I had the right away and cited other party a citation for 'Fail to stop a red light M1557680(Ticket #)'











Here is my next concern. I went to tow lot to look at how intensive the damage is.
It looks like I have frame damage. Also RIGID 3point strut bar fucked up my other side and firewall too. What do you guys think? You think it's fixable?
If not, I'd probably buy it back to sell the parts but what car would be worthy replacement? It can't be too much more than the Type-R. Currently I'm paying $333 for car. Suggestion will be greatly appreciated.
